                        • Dangerous opponents for Fairmont and WLU
                          Glenville won both games this season vs Fairmont.
                          At Feb 11 game at WLU, CU ran into the perfect storm of WLU on fire from three. From a 7 point halftime lead, WLU grew the lead to 50.
                          However, CU has the athletic players, pg, coach and rebounding to challenge WLU. Rahama averaged a double double for season.

                          CU keys:
                          • control the boards
                          • Attack the rim after breaking the press
                          • Shoot much better than wlu
                          • Get WLU in foul trouble
                          • Limit fatigue
                          WLU keys:
                          • Get back on defense
                          • Exert pressure on offense and defense
                          • 2nd platoon must exert extreme pressure
                          • Force CU to use their thin, young bench and then attack them
                          • Avoid ill-advised fouls
                          • Double Rahama to make him pick up ball
                          • Shoot at least 35% from three

                            • Observations from a Dummy - NDC vs WLU 3/4/23

                              NDC is a dangerous team . They defeated Charleston by 13 and defeated Youngstown State and Wvsu yesterday. They are a young, talented team, with 3 sophomores and 2 seniors/grad students on the starting 5. They are strong 1-on-1 players, which is both a blessing and a curse. NDC might be an elite team next year, as they get older. They have the second leading scorer in the MEC in willis.


                              Tale of the Tape (Season)

                              NDC WLU

                              Points 81 101

                              FT % 77% 74%

                              FG % 44% 49%

                              3FG% 36% 39%

                              Turnovers 14 12

                              Assists 14 23

                              Assist/TO ratio 1.0 1.9

                              NDC Strategy

                              · Play tight defense - FAIL fatigue allowed many open looks but they did get steals on 47% of 17 wlu turnovers

                              · Minimize turnovers against WLU pressure - FAIL committed 21 turnovers of which 67% were live ball steals
                              · Use motion offense with multiple screens in rapid-fire succession to free up their talented players to finish at the rim. Get Jaedon Willis open looks as he is averaging 21 points per game, 40% from three and 89% of FTs. - PARTIAL SUCCESS Willis made difficult shots in the paint but held to his average,

                              · Try to draw fouls and get WLU in foul trouble. Make FTs. FAIL WLU had 4 players with 4, but they occurred too late to affect outcome

                              · Shoot the 3 effectively. Three starters shoot over 40% from three. - FAIL 2 for 18 for 11%

                              · Deny Rasile open looks from three. FAIL Rasile 3-5 60%

                              · Keep WLU off the offensive glass and win the rebounding battle. PASS won off. reb 16-13 and was close in def. Reb 20-22

                              · Double team Butler in the lane to prevent inside moves. FAIL Butler had 22 points and 16 rebounds

                              · Avoid the WLU blackouts. FAIL WLU had several that opened a lead. But NDC did not collapse and lose by 40.
